Aluminum Rises to Near 6-Week High

Aluminum futures in the UK climbed above $3,210 per tonne, their highest level in nearly six weeks, driven by persistent supply constraints and slower output growth. Production outside China fell 6.7% year-on-year in July, largely reflecting lower operating rates at several smelters in the Middle East. These pressures have been exacerbated by China’s 45 million-ton annual production cap, which is expected to become increasingly restrictive this year.

Geopolitical tensions have further tightened the market, prompting consumers to draw down exchange inventories, with LME stocks dropping to their lowest level this century. Adding to supply worries, Alcoa Corp. cut its production guidance after operational issues at an Australian refinery.

Some of these constraints may be mitigated by planned capacity restarts and expansion projects. Notably, the Slovalco smelter in Slovakia is scheduled to restart in Q4 2026, and Metals’ Missouri smelter is expected to resume operations by year-end. Emirates Global Aluminium is also continuing to restore production at its Al Taweelah facility.
